Can Chiropractic Care Improve Athletic Performance?

Athletes are always looking for different ways to increase their performance in their respective sports. There are many ways that can help when it comes to gaining an edge over the competition. One of them is chiropractic care. With chiropractic care, an athlete can boost their performance and also prevent injury or even recover faster from an existing injury. Chiropractic care for athletes has come a long way over the years, and now professional sports organizations, such as the NFL, NBA, MLB and PGA, utilize chiropractic care to help aid players and make sure they are in top shape to perform. In this post, we will look at some ways chiropractic care can help athletes of any level to perform to the best of their ability.

  1. Preventing Injuries

When it comes to preventing injuries, chiropractic care can really help. This is done by restoring optimal mobility to the joints, helping with balance issues, and making sure that the nerves coming out of the spine have no pressure on them. Ensuring that the joints are mobile will help make the muscles, tendons, and ligaments in the area less susceptible to injury. Balance issues can be corrected through specific exercises to help the patient with their coordination. Balance can also be affected if there is a discrepancy in leg lengths. Sometimes one leg is naturally shorter than the other, and at Apex Chiropractic we take a leg length x-ray to determine if that is the case. To combat this we offer heel lifts to balance out the pelvis, which can help with overall balance issues. Making sure the nerves coming from the spine are healthy helps with better range of motion, reduction in pain and tension in the muscles and joints, as well as improved recovery time following injuries. 

  1. Faster Recovery

Most athletes receive a rehabilitative program when they are injured. Chiropractors can design rehabilitative plans to help with recovery. Spinal adjustments help with increased mobility in the joints and also help with nerve issues. Making sure that the nerves are healthy and that there is no pressure on them can help ensure that the nervous system is working at its optimal level. Using modalities such as electrical muscle stimulation (e-stim) can also enhance recovery time. When using e-stim, a small unit sends mild electrical impulses to the injured area. This helps increase blood flow and decrease inflammation. Adding these treatments to a specific care plan is a very useful way to aid in recovery time.

  1. Improved Performance

Everything in the body is connected through the nervous system. When there is a mishap or issue in the nervous system, it can alter even the most basic tasks. Chiropractors are professionals who have studied extensively about the nervous system along with the musculoskeletal system. If the nervous system is not functioning at its optimal level, coordination and reaction time can be affected, which is essential for athletes to perform to the best of their abilities. It can also hinder the muscles’ strength, which can lead to injuries. Receiving chiropractic care can help make sure that the nervous system is performing at an optimal level. This is done through adjustments to the spine and making sure that the nerves are functioning properly. Receiving chiropractic care can help an athlete perform at the highest level they possibly can.
